Output ec0ccdbc650b53fb26b8d2a9118a6fff4bcc2535d0c19ac24919e431cd4ba07e:1

value
46177
script pubkey
OP_0 OP_PUSHBYTES_20 7861d29961d388ffed2500256b2330bd75e81a68
address
bc1q0psa9xtp6wy0lmf9qqjkkgesh467sxngc4hzw2
transaction
ec0ccdbc650b53fb26b8d2a9118a6fff4bcc2535d0c19ac24919e431cd4ba07e
confirmations
17604
spent
true